#49326c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#49326c is composed of 28.6% red, 19.6%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.4% cyan, 53.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 263.8 degrees, a saturation of 36.7% and a lightness of 31%. #49326c color hex could be obtained by blending #9264d8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#49326c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f5f2f9 is the lightest one.
